Mike wrote:

> I tracked things down to pack_texture.c in the 1.35 change list which is 
> causing the texture crashes for me.  It looks like some of the additions 
> of crPackFree()'s are incorrect and freeing NULL pointers...  We need to 
> take a longer look at that change list and probably back it out for now.

I think the proper fix is to simply remove the crPackFree() calls from
those functions.  When crHugePacket() is called, we wind up in a SPU
function like packspuHuge() or tilesortHuge() which call crPackFree()
themselves.

We should probably add a comment to crHugePacket() in pack_buffer.c to
indicate that the caller should _not_ call crPackFree() and that it's up to
the SPU routine called via pc->SendHuge() to do so.
